Planting Calendar for Romaine lettuce

Frost tolerance for romaine lettuce: Very tolerant of frost.
When to plant: Up to 7 weeks before last frost.

You can plant romaine lettuce a lot earlier in the year because they are very cold tolerant.

The earliest that you can plant romaine lettuce in Kittanning is February. However, you really should wait until March if you don't want to take any chances.

The last month that you can plant romaine lettuce and expect a good harvest is probably September. You probably don't want to wait any later than that or else your romaine lettuce may not have a chance to grow to maturity. You can get started a little bit earlier by starting your romaine lettuce indoors.

Last Frost Date

The average date of last frost is April 15 in Kittanning. In the coldest months of winter you should expect an average low temperature of -10°F.

Remember that USDA zone info for Kittanning may not be accurate from year to year and the actual date of last frost is different every year. Half of the time in Kittanning it frosts late in the year after April 15 so always be ready to cover your romaine lettuce if you have one of those late frosts.

USDA Zone Info for Kittanning

Here is the info for USDA Zone 6a.

Average Date of Last Frost (spring)April 15
Average Date of First Frost (fall)October 15
Lowest Expected Low-10°F
Highest Expected Low-5°F

This means that on a really cold year, the coldest it will get is -10°F. On most years you should be prepared to experience lows near -5°F.
